GREENEVILLE, Tenn. --- The Tusculum College
men's tennis team posted a 9-0 shutout over visiting Johnson C.
Smith University Saturday afternoon at the Nichols Tennis
Complex.
The Pioneers (2-0) won in straight sets in all of its singles
matches. Tusculum got singles wins from Thomas
Rees, Henrique Rodrigues, Thomas
Clayton, Thomas Kiser, Leo
Guaycurus and Hunter Beal. TC's
Steven Lin recorded a point at No. 3 doubles with
Clayton.
Tusculum returns to action next Saturday when they host the Queens
University of Charlotte at the Nichols Tennis Complex.
